Text of card

Creatures with any landwalk ability may be blocked as though they did not have those abilities.

"We found this staff useful on our visit to this very commission. Would Relicbane prefer we had been slain by Lim-Dûl's horrors?" —Arcum Dagsson, Soldevi Machinist

Rules and information

The reference guide for Magic: The Gathering Staff of the Ages card rulings provides official rulings, any errata issued, as well as a record of all the functional modifications that have occurred.

Date Text
2004-10-04 It does not remove Landwalk from creatures. It just makes creatures with landwalk blockable as if they did not have the ability.
